Course description

A 3-hour practical workshop

Successful management of any thoracic syndrome is contingent upon two factors:

  • the therapist’s ability to constantly assess and interpret the history and clinical signs and symptoms of the disorder; and

  • the skill of administering therapeutic techniques.

This workshop presents a unique clinical method of assessment and treatment of thoracic spine disorders.

In addition, the thoracic spine presents a significant challenge to the clinician, not least because this region has been somewhat neglected in terms of new research and the publication of clinical papers. A further challenge to the therapist is that some somatic, musculoskeletal conditions may co-exist with, superimpose, or mimic visceral conditions.
